Northeast Environmental Studies Group (NEES) Annual Meeting
November 10-12, 2000
Williams College, Williamstown, MA

The Center for Environmental Studies at Williams College is pleased to host the annual Northeast Environmental Studies Group meeting. This meeting will be an opportunity for faculty and administrators of both undergraduate and graduate programs in environmental studies and environmental science to gather and discuss the issues they feel are most important to their programs. In addition to large group discussions and smaller breakout groups, we will be hosting several field trips to interesting sites near the Williams campus. We have also planned for there to be plenty of time for informal meetings and discussions.

The opening reception, dinners on Friday and Saturday nights, and several of the meeting sessions will be help at Elm Tree House on Mount Hope Farm, located just a few miles south of campus. Elm Tree House also has several guest rooms where conference participants can stay overnight - please see the lodging section for more information.
